I'm using Mac OS® X and the Brother machine does not appear in the Print Center or Printer Setup Utility. What can I do?

If your Brother machine does not appear in the "Printer List" window of the Print Center or Printer Setup Utility, please follow the directions below to correct the situation.

 


  1. Disconnect the cable from the computer and the Brother machine.
    Connect the end of the USB cable directly to the Mac CPU. Connect the other end of the USB cable directly to the Brother machine.

  2. Restart the computer.
    (Click on the Apple Menu and choose Restart.)

  3. Open Print Center or Printer Setup Utility.
    In order to locate the Print Center or Printer Setup Utility application, please go to the Utilities folder, located within the Applications folder.
    (Applications -> Utilities -> Print Center or Printer Setup Utility)

  4. Choose the USB connection type from the drop down menu.

  5. Select your model printer from the listed items.

  6. Click Add.
    At this point, you should see your model listed in the main body of the Print Center or Printer Setup Utility window. The driver is now selected and active on the system. You can exit the Print Center or Printer Setup Utility.

If the name of the product does not appear in the Printer List of the Print Center or Printer Setup Utility, the Mac does not see the unit. Please be sure that the length of the USB cable does not exceed 6 feet (2 meters) or you may also want to replace the USB cable with another, known working cable.
